    What Artemisia said.There are soooo many attractions in Southern Spain you wont care for bdancing,really.By the way,i will be for one week in Granada arriving on April 7.Is one of the most beautiful Moorish flavored provinces in the South.You wont want to miss having some relax and tea at the hamman here,and they might have a bdance performance on Fridays or Sat evenings for patrons there.This part you will have to ask because it can be changed:

    Arab Baths in Granada - Leisure accommodation in Granada - Granada Hammam

    You will be thrilled just by walking around the old city centre of Granada and visiting the lovely Albayzin:

    Monuments in Granada, Spain: El Barrio del Albaycin. Cultural tourism in Andalusia, Spain.

    Besides the wide array of tapas bars on the vicinity of the Plaza Nueva at skirts of the Albayzin,if you want to experience the flavours of Moroccan cuisine right in the middle of this neighborhood step up the Cuesta Marañas cobbled streets and into Restaurant Arrayanes:
